About Tonduff

Tonduff is a small village located in County Moyle, Northern Ireland, with the postcode area BT57. It is surrounded by the natural beauty of the Northern Irish landscape, making it a suitable spot for those who appreciate the outdoors. The village is characterised by its rural setting, with fields and hills nearby, offering opportunities for walking and exploring the local environment. Crime and Anti-Social Behaviour in Tonduff

Local crime rates sit lower than national averages. Anti-social behaviour accounts for the highest share in Tonduff, with 2 incidents logged in January 2026.
